I don't know about the 680 version of Microsoft BASIC but in the early 8800 versions, you can set NULL 2 or higher before writing a tape so that there will be some space added after each line. You then set the same NULL number to read the tape back. This gives the processor time to enter each line. In the later versions of MS BASIC, NULL isn't necessary. BASIC can read in the file at full speed (110 baud - Wow!) from paper tape.

So far in my experimentation I am finding that I must set a line delay of about 500ms in hyperterminal to send a basic listing to microsoft basic. Not optimal, but it isn't too bad. Anything less causes corruption and the program is not entered correctly.

There's no paper tape SAVE command in the 8800 versions of BASIC. If you type LIST, then turn on the Teletype tape punch and press Return, the tape will be punched and contain the listing with an additional OK at the end. This can then be read into a BASIC session but will give a Syntax Error because of the OK. The entire program will be in memory, though.
